ReadyScan LED light source:

A scanner’s light source illuminating two-dimensional objects as they pass under the sensor to record an image is usually a cold cathode fluorescent lamp (CCFL). They consume more power than other types of lamps and produce more heat, which has negative effects on both the environment and customer electricity bills.

The V600 uses an LED light to replace the more wasteful CCFLs, which can reduce scanning times and power consumption by around half. It also takes less time to reach a stable light level than older models.

The V600’s lid opens to reveal a film scanner with two reversible templates that sit on the flatbed and align with pin locations on the glass platen. The A tab on the first template scans 35mm filmstrips, while C does mount slides and B is for medium format. Faster scans:

The V600 Photo is a workhorse scanner that can quickly digitize photos, prints, 35mm film, and slides. Its maximum resolution of 6400 x 9600 dpi allows for enlargements up to 17 x 22″. It also features Digital Ice for dust and scratch removal.

The device is equipped with a set of function buttons that are operated with just one touch: With one button the scan software can generate a searchable PDF file and another can automatically send the scanned image to an e-mail program or printer. So, the device can also be connected directly to a PC with the included cable.

The device comes with a full software suite for Windows, Mac OS X 10.3.9 through 10.6, and Linux. A complete version of SilverFast is also available as an upgrade, which increases the number of optimizing options. The Epson Perfection V600 Photo is a workhorse designed to quickly turn analog documents and photographs into high-quality digital images. It has good archiving features, a large flatbed, and a set of film holders for 35mm and medium format.

Unlike most flatbed scanners, the V600 doesn’t require a warm-up period, thanks to the energy-efficient ReadyScan LED light source. That means it can get started scanning right away, without any wasted power. It also uses less power for each scan, delivering higher productivity and lower operating costs.

The built-in Photo Restoration feature works well to restore faded colors on snapshot prints. There’s a handy feature to remove dust and scratches on film scans, too. However, if you’re scanning more than one print or transparency at the same time, the software doesn’t automatically separate them.

Bundled software is pretty typical for a professional-grade scanner. The utility is available in four modes with increasing levels of control: Full Auto simply scans whatever is on the flatbed, Home mode offers some extra settings but with an eye on productivity, and Office mode has a wealth of options. All models include Adobe Photoshop Elements 7 (Windows) or 6.0 (Mac), as well as Abbyy FineReader Sprint Plus for optical character recognition (OCR). There are four customizable buttons on the front of the unit for scan-to-email, copy, and PDF creation.
